Features
Low Power Consumption
150mV Dropout at 150mA
1% Output Voltage Accuracy
Requires only 0.47µF Output Capacitor
Only 135µA Ground Current at 150mA load
50µV
RMS
Noise at BW = 300Hz to 50kHz
Excellent Line and Load Transient Response
Over Current/Over Temperature Protection
8-pin MSOP package
Voltage Options Available: 3.3/3.3V, 3.0/3.0V, 3.0/2.8V,
3.0/2.5V, 2.8/2.8V, 2.85/2.85V. Other Custom Values
available upon request.
Minimum External Components

General Description
The ILC7280 is two independent 150mA low dropout
(LDO)voltage regulators in an 8-pin MSOP package. Each
regulator output is independently short circuit protected and
has independent enable lines. The device offers a unique
combination of low dropout voltage and low quiescent
current offered by CMOS technology as well as the low
noise and good ripple rejection characteristics of bipolar
LDO regulators.
The ILC7280 is available in a space saving MSOP-8
package.
